The 2nd edition 1787 contained a refutation of idealism to distinguish his transcendental idealism from descartess sceptical idealism and berkeleys antirealist strain of subjective idealism. Feb 14, 2020 transcendental idealism, also called formalistic idealism, term applied to the epistemology of the 18thcentury german philosopher immanuel kant, who held that the human self, or transcendental ego, constructs knowledge out of sense impressions and from universal concepts called categories that it imposes upon them.
